Handover Note — Directors, Pellwick Trading Co.

For the board: passing the quarterly cash-flow file from my desk to Rena's. Short version — inflows are tracking slightly ahead thanks to the Marle contract, outflows bump up in month two for warehouse works. Nothing alarming, but watch the receivables aging on the Dunmere account. Rena has full context. The confidential planning note sits just below.

board note of fahif-yahog: Gross margin on Wenath came in at 10 percent against a plan of 5 percent. Only 3 of the 100 pilot accounts renewed Wenath, so a churn review is set for July 15.

## FixtureForge: Contacts

FixtureForge is our in-house test-data factory library, maintained by the Build Reliability group at Osprey Peak Software. For questions about factory definitions, seeding order, or flaky fixture generation, check the troubleshooting page first. Bugs and feature requests go through the tracker. For anything urgent — broken releases, corrupted seed data — email the maintainers directly.

escalation mailbox, hadug-bajog: sormir@norvalabs.internal

# Env file — Cartwheel dispatch, driver-assignment heuristic
# Scope: staging only. Do not promote to prod.
# The heuristic weights (proximity, shift balance, refusal rate) are tuned
# for the Velmont pilot region and will misbehave elsewhere.
# Review notes: heuristic service runs unprivileged; it reads weights
# read-only from the tuning store and writes nothing back.
# Only one sensitive value exists in this file: the tuning-store access
# credential, consumed at boot and never logged.
# That credential is set on the following line.

secret setting of faduf-bahop: LEDGER_TOKEN8=c3b363be